Explicit compatibility is stated for a comprehensive range of Garmin smartwatches, including the Fenix 7, 7S, 7X, 6, 5, 5X series, as well as the Forerunner 955, Venu 2 Plus, and Swim 2. The product is offered as a pack of 10 individual dust covers, presented in a diverse array of colors including yellow, red, teal, white, purple, black, blue, green, grey, and pink.
